How to reset the tire pressure light on a Toyota RAV4?

1 Answers
CaydenLynn
07/29/25 11:55pm
The methods to reset the tire pressure light on a Toyota RAV4 are: 1. Locate the tire pressure reset button and press and hold it; 2. Visit a 4S shop for a computer reset. Taking the 2020 Toyota RAV4 as an example, it belongs to the compact SUV category, with body dimensions of: length 4600mm, width 1855mm, height 1680mm, and a wheelbase of 2690mm. The 2020 Toyota RAV4 features a front MacPherson independent suspension and a rear E-type multi-link independent suspension. It is equipped with a 2.0L naturally aspirated engine, delivering a maximum horsepower of 171PS, a maximum power of 126kW, and a maximum torque of 209Nm, paired with a 10-speed continuously variable transmission.

What are the steps for keyless start in a manual transmission car?

Steps for keyless start in a manual transmission car: 1. Press the start button once to activate the vehicle's power supply. The vehicle will begin self-check, and all indicator lights on the dashboard will illuminate. If no issues are detected after the self-check, all warning lights will turn off; 2. Press the start button again to ignite the engine; 3. After ignition, let the engine warm up for about a minute, fasten your seatbelt, press the brake and clutch pedals, shift into first gear, release the handbrake, and then release the clutch and brake pedals to start moving. Some models feature a twist-type keyless start instead of a button. The principle is the same: twist once to activate the power supply, and twist again to ignite the engine.

What are the advantages of a double ball joint suspension?

The advantages of a double ball joint suspension: 1. It can reduce body roll and suppress brake dive; 2. It can improve steering precision. The double ball joint suspension is an improved version based on the MacPherson suspension. This suspension replaces the L-shaped control arm of the MacPherson independent suspension with two links, creating two connection points between the suspension and the steering knuckle, hence its name. The double ball joint suspension can enhance vehicle handling. The more connection points between the suspension and the steering knuckle, the better. The double ball joint suspension has one more connection point than the MacPherson suspension, so vehicles equipped with this suspension offer superior handling. Common independent suspensions found in cars include the double ball joint suspension, MacPherson suspension, multi-link suspension, double wishbone suspension, and double transverse arm suspension.

Is a Dual-Clutch Transmission Considered an Automatic Transmission?

Automobile dual-clutch is an automatic transmission. Dual-clutch refers to the dual-clutch transmission (DCT), which consists of two sets of clutches working simultaneously—one managing the odd-numbered gears and the other handling the even-numbered gears. This design avoids the power interruption issue during gear shifts in traditional manual transmissions, achieving rapid gear changes. The dual-clutch transmission differs from conventional automatic transmission systems; it is based on a manual transmission yet belongs to the automatic transmission category, serving as a transmission mechanism capable of both power delivery and interruption. The primary function of a dual-clutch is to ensure smooth vehicle starts, reduce impact loads on transmission gears during shifts, and prevent drivetrain overload.

How to Overtake with a Tiptronic Transmission?

When overtaking with a tiptronic transmission, you need to press the accelerator pedal deeply. At this time, the transmission will automatically downshift, and the engine speed will increase, allowing for smooth overtaking. If the vehicle's transmission responds relatively slowly, the driver can directly switch to manual mode when quick overtaking is needed, then manually downshift and press the accelerator deeply to achieve rapid overtaking. A tiptronic transmission is an automatic transmission with a manual mode. After switching to manual mode, the driver can manually control upshifting or downshifting. The manual mode of a tiptronic transmission is used during aggressive driving or when quick overtaking is required. A manual transmission allows the driver to select any gear, while the manual mode of an automatic transmission only permits the driver to manually control upshifting and downshifting, without the ability to directly select a specific gear.

What does an exclamation mark displayed on a car mean?

The meaning of an exclamation mark displayed on a car depends on different situations: 1. If the exclamation mark is inside a red triangle, it indicates a general fault light; 2. If the exclamation mark is inside a red circle with brackets, it indicates a brake system warning light; 3. If the exclamation mark is below a yellow bracket with a horizontal line in the middle, it indicates a tire pressure monitoring warning light; 4. If the exclamation mark is inside a yellow light bulb, it indicates a lighting system fault indicator; 5. If the exclamation mark is next to a red steering wheel, it indicates a steering system fault indicator. An exclamation mark displayed on a car means that the vehicle has a fault or abnormality, which may affect driving safety and damage the vehicle, requiring inspection and repair.
